Q: Is 11,333,136 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 11,333,136 is not a prime number.

Why is 11,333,136 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 11333136 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 16 24 48 236,107 472,214 708,321 944,428 1,416,642 1,888,856 2,833,284 3,777,712 5,666,568 and 11,333,136, with no remainder.

Since 11,333,136 cannot be divided by just 1 and 11,333,136, it is not a prime number.
